Data Analyst KIM
[프로그래머스Lv0] 모음제거 - python 본문
반응형
프로그래머스
코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.
programmers.co.kr
<나의 코드>
def solution(my_string):
answer = []
mu = ["a","e","i","o","u"]
for i in str(my_string) :
if i not in mu :
answer.append(i)
return ''.join(answer)
<다른 사람 코드>
def solution(my_string):
return "".join([i for i in my_string if not(i in "aeiou")])
항상 이런 문제를 풀때 내 코드는 하나의 코드로 가능하다는 것을 매번 알게됨.
항상 풀고 나면 다른 사람 코드도 보면서 정리를 하는데 이게 정말 중요하다.
반응형
'데이터 분석 > Coding Test' 카테고리의 다른 글
[프로그래머스Lv0] 순서쌍의 개수 - python (0) | 2023.04.27 |
---|---|
[프로그래머스Lv0] 암호 해독 - python (0) | 2023.04.21 |
[프로그래머스Lv0] 숨어있는 숫자의 덧셈(1) - python (0) | 2023.04.16 |
[프로그래머스Lv0] 문자열 정렬하기 - python (0) | 2023.04.15 |
[프로그래머스] 세균증식 - python (0) | 2023.04.15 |